web前端专业基本能力是什么意思
-
Web前端专业基本能力指的是在Web前端开发领域中所具备的基本知识、技能和能力。具体来说,Web前端专业基本能力包括以下几个方面:
-
HTML和CSS基础能力:掌握HTML和CSS的基本语法,能够编写符合标准的网页结构和样式。了解HTML5和CSS3的新特性和用法,能够运用各种常见的布局方式和样式效果。
-
JavaScript编程能力:熟悉JavaScript的基本语法和常用对象、方法,能够通过JavaScript实现网页的交互效果和动态功能。了解ES6及以上版本的新特性,能够运用常见的JavaScript库和框架,如jQuery、React等。
-
前端框架和工具使用能力:掌握常见的前端框架和工具的使用,如Bootstrap、Vue、Angular等。能够运用这些框架和工具快速开发前端页面和应用,提高开发效率。
-
前端性能优化能力:了解前端性能优化的原理和方法,在开发过程中注意网页的加载速度、响应速度和渲染性能。能够通过压缩、合并、缓存等手段优化前端资源的加载和使用,提升用户体验。
-
跨平台和响应式设计能力:具备实现跨平台和响应式设计的能力,能够确保网页在不同浏览器、设备和屏幕尺寸上的良好展示效果。了解移动端开发的特点和技术,能够开发适配移动设备的网页和应用。
-
团队协作和沟通能力:能够与团队成员有效地合作,参与项目的需求分析、设计和开发工作。具备良好的沟通能力,能够与设计师、后端开发人员等其他团队成员进行有效的沟通和协调。
综上所述,Web前端专业基本能力涵盖了HTML和CSS基础能力、JavaScript编程能力、前端框架和工具使用能力、前端性能优化能力、跨平台和响应式设计能力,以及团队协作和沟通能力等多个方面,这些能力是成为一名合格的Web前端开发人员的基本要求。
1年前 -
-
Web前端专业基本能力指的是拥有一定的技术和知识,能够独立完成Web前端开发工作的能力。下面是Web前端专业基本能力的几个方面:
-
掌握HTML和CSS:HTML是用于创建网页结构的标记语言,CSS是用于控制网页样式的样式语言。前端开发者需要掌握HTML和CSS,能够编写语义化的HTML代码,并能使用CSS来美化和布局网页。
-
熟悉JavaScript:JavaScript是用于给网页添加交互和动态功能的脚本语言。前端开发者需要掌握JavaScript的基本语法,能够编写简单的脚本,并熟悉一些常用的JavaScript库和框架,如jQuery、React等。
-
理解响应式设计和移动端开发:响应式设计是指网页能够根据不同设备的屏幕大小和分辨率自动调整布局和样式,以适应不同的设备。前端开发者需要了解响应式设计的原理和实现方法,并能够编写适应不同设备的网页。同时,还需要熟悉移动端开发的一些特点和技术,如CSS媒体查询、flex布局等。
-
掌握前端开发工具和框架:前端开发中常用的工具和框架有很多,如代码编辑器(如Visual Studio Code)、版本管理工具(如Git)、构建工具(如Webpack、Gulp)等。前端开发者需要熟悉这些工具的使用方法,并能够灵活运用它们来提高开发效率。
-
具备良好的设计和沟通能力:作为前端开发者,不仅需要具备技术能力,还需要具备良好的设计和沟通能力。前端开发者需要能够理解产品需求和设计师的设计意图,并能够将其转化为网页的实际效果。此外,前端开发者还需要与团队成员进行有效的沟通和协作,以便高效地完成项目。
总之,Web前端专业基本能力包括掌握HTML和CSS,熟悉JavaScript,理解响应式设计和移动端开发,掌握前端开发工具和框架,并具备良好的设计和沟通能力。
1年前 -
-
"web前端专业基本能力"指的是在从事web前端开发工作时所需具备的基本技能和能力。以下是关于web前端专业基本能力的详细解释。
一、HTML和CSS基础能力
HTML和CSS是web前端开发的基础,掌握HTML和CSS的语法和语义化标签,能够编写符合标准的HTML和CSS代码,实现页面的结构和样式布局。1.1 HTML基础能力
-了解HTML的基本标签和属性,如<div>,<h1>,<p>,<a>等。
-掌握HTML5新增的语义化标签,如<header>,<footer>,<nav>,<section>等
-理解HTML标签的嵌套关系和语义化的重要性
-能够使用表格、表单、图像等常用HTML元素进行页面制作1.2 CSS基础能力
-了解CSS的基本语法和选择器,如类选择器、ID选择器等
-能够掌握CSS的常用属性和常用样式,如颜色、字体、背景、边框等
-理解盒子模型的概念,并能够进行盒子模型的布局和调整
-能够使用CSS3进行动画和过渡效果的实现
-了解响应式设计的概念和技术,能够使用媒体查询等技术实现响应式布局二、JavaScript编程能力
JavaScript是web前端开发中最重要的编程语言之一,掌握JavaScript编程能力可以实现页面的交互和动态效果。2.1 JavaScript基础能力
-了解JavaScript的基本语法和数据类型,如变量、数组、对象、函数等
-掌握JavaScript的基本操作和常用API,如字符串、数组、日期、正则表达式等
-理解JavaScript的作用域和闭包的概念,能够避免变量命名冲突和内存泄漏
-掌握JavaScript的事件处理和DOM操作,能够通过JavaScript实现页面的动态交互
-了解异步编程的概念和常用技术,如回调函数、Promise、async/await等2.2 JavaScript框架和库
-了解常用的JavaScript框架和库,如jQuery、Vue.js、React.js等
-能够使用框架和库进行快速开发和构建优化的前端应用
-理解框架和库的工作原理和使用方法,能够解决常见的开发问题和实现复杂的前端功能三、前端工具和调试能力
前端开发过程中,需要使用一些工具来辅助开发、调试和优化前端应用。3.1 前端开发工具
-掌握常用的前端开发工具,如编辑器、命令行工具、版本控制工具等
-能够使用开发工具进行代码编辑、调试、构建和部署等操作
-了解前端开发工具的配置和使用技巧,能够提高开发效率和代码质量3.2 调试和性能优化
-能够使用浏览器的开发者工具进行页面的调试和问题定位
-了解前端性能优化的基本原则和常用技术,如HTTP优化、代码压缩、图片优化等
-能够使用性能分析工具进行性能测试和优化,提升前端应用的加载速度和响应速度四、团队协作和沟通能力
在实际的工作中,web前端开发往往需要与其他开发人员、设计师和产品经理等进行协作和沟通。4.1 团队协作能力
-能够与团队成员合作,共同完成项目的开发和交付
-能够理解项目需求和功能设计,能够根据需求进行代码编写和功能测试
-具备良好的代码规范和注释书写习惯,方便他人理解和维护代码4.2 沟通能力
-能够与其他团队成员进行有效的沟通,协商和解决问题
-能够理解和表达清晰的技术概念和思路,使其他成员能够理解和接受自己的观点总结起来,web前端专业基本能力包括HTML和CSS基础能力、JavaScript编程能力、前端工具和调试能力,以及团队协作和沟通能力。这些能力是web前端开发者在实际工作中必须掌握的基本技能,能够帮助他们进行页面开发和优化,并与团队成员高效协作,实现优质的前端应用。
1年前